Position Summary

The Vice President of Capital Marketing is responsible for leading the company’s secondary mortgage strategy, including loan pricing, hedging, investor execution, and delivery performance. This executive will oversee the sale of mortgage loans into the secondary market, optimize execution across investors and aggregators, and manage pipeline risk to support profitability, liquidity, and operational efficiency. The role requires deep knowledge of mortgage markets, strong investor relationships, and proven execution discipline across volatile interest rate environments.

Responsibilities
  • Develop and execute the company’s secondary marketing strategy, including pricing, hedging, and loan sale execution
  • Oversee daily and long‑term management of the mortgage pipeline to optimize best execution and manage interest rate risk
  • Establish and maintain pricing strategies aligned with market conditions, margin targets, and investor guidelines
  • Lead loan sale execution across whole loan, correspondent, and agency channels as applicable
  • Manage investor relationships, approvals, and performance scorecards
  • Oversee hedging strategies and tools to mitigate pipeline fallout and market volatility
  • Monitor and analyze secondary market trends, rate movements, investor behavior, and competitive pricing
  • Partner closely with production, lock desk, capital markets operations, and finance to align pricing, execution, and profitability goals
  • Ensure compliance with investor guidelines, agency requirements, and regulatory standards
  • Oversee delivery, purchase advice reconciliation, and post‑sale issue resolution
  • Prepare and present secondary marketing performance reporting, margin analysis, and market commentary to senior leadership
  • Identify and manage secondary‑market‑related risks, including fallout, pair‑offs, and investor exposure
  • Support strategic initiatives related to product expansion, investor diversification, and channel growth
  • Mentor and manage secondary marketing, lock desk, or capital markets team members as applicable
